服务器扩容必须重启吗?不同场景应对方案、避坑指南全解析,服务器扩容重启需知,多场景方案与避坑攻略解析
哎,各位刚入门的运维萌新们,有没有遇到过这种抓狂时刻?网站访问量蹭蹭涨,赶紧给服务器升级配置,结果被告知要停机重启——业务高峰期停服?这不是要老板命嘛!今天咱们就唠明白服务器扩容到底要不要重启,保你看完就能找到最合适的升级姿势!
硬件升级:必须重启的"换心脏手术"
先给大伙儿打个比方:给服务器加内存条就像给汽车换发动机,必须熄火才能操作。这类硬件升级三大特征:
- 物理接触式操作: *** 内存条、更换CPU都得开箱,带电操作会烧主板
- 系统识别需求:新硬件需要重新加载驱动,就跟新员工入职得办工牌似的
- 稳定性测试必要:去年某电商加内存没重启,结果数据库缓存错乱,直接损失30万订单
必须重启的硬件升级清单:
- 增加物理内存条
- 更换CPU处理器
- 扩展RAID阵列硬盘
- 升级万兆网卡

例外情况: 支持热 *** 的SAS硬盘和电源,可以像U盘即插即用,但需要专业存储设备支持
软件升级:灵活操作的"在线换轮胎"
这里有个好消息:80%的软件升级不用停机!去年某直播平台边升级Nginx边扛住百万并发,靠的就是这些骚操作:
- Web服务:nginx -s reload 重载配置,跟刷新网页一样方便
- 数据库:MySQL主从切换,把流量引到备用库再升级主库
- 容器应用:K8s滚动更新,逐个替换Pod就像接力赛跑
但有两种情况必须停机:
- 操作系统内核升级:好比给房子换地基,必须推倒重来
- 底层虚拟化平台升级:VMware从6.5升7.0,就像给游轮换引擎
云服务器玄学:阿里云/腾讯云的特殊规则
国内主流云平台的操作简直像开盲盒!这里整理个对比表帮你看清门道:
扩容类型 | 阿里云 | 腾讯云 | 华为云 |
---|---|---|---|
CPU/内存升级 | 必须重启 | 必须重启 | 必须重启 |
云盘扩容 | 在线扩容 | 在线扩容 | 仅支持离线 |
带宽升级 | VPC免重启 | 必须重启 | 必须重启 |
跨代实例变更 | 必须迁移 | 必须迁移 | 必须迁移 |
血泪教训: 去年某创业公司给阿里云ECS升配没重启,结果新配置半个月都没生效,被投资人骂得狗血淋头
免重启黑科技:运维 *** 的保命绝招
不想停机?这几招能救急:
- LVM在线扩容:像橡皮筋拉伸硬盘空间,支持ext4/xfs文件系统
- 内存热添加:戴尔PowerEdge服务器支持不停机加内存,价格贵三倍
- 容器化改造:把应用打包成Docker,升级时秒级切换
- 负载均衡切换:用NGINX把流量切到备用集群,主集群慢慢升级
避坑重点: 金融系统升级数据库必须停服校验,某银行强行在线升级导致小数点错位,差点引发挤兑风波
特殊场景处理方案
遇到这些情况就别头铁了:
- Windows服务器:virtio驱动版本低于58011必须重启
- 老旧物理机:2015年前的设备基本不支持热 ***
- *** 单位服务器:等保三级要求变更必须留痕,重启是规定动作
- 超融合架构:Nutanix集群升级得逐个节点滚动重启
有个取巧办法:用虚拟化层做资源池,业务层根本感知不到硬件变化。某国企用VMware虚拟化,三年没停服完成三次硬件升级
搞了十年运维的老张头说句掏心话:能在线升级就别重启,跟老板汇报时一定要留足缓冲时间! 新手记住三点:
- 买服务器认准热 *** 认证标志
- 重要业务系统升级前做全量备份
- 阿里云控制台升级比API操作更稳妥
下次再碰上扩容需求,先掏出手机看看这篇文章——保你既能搞定升级又不背锅!这年头运维岗如履薄冰,可别在重启这事上栽跟头啊!